--> The National Teaching Council seeks to recruit Regional and District-level Teacher Portfolio Assessors.
Regional Assessors visit Districts to carry out the quality verification of Newly Qualified Teachers’ (NQTs) portfolios which are initially assessed/evaluated by the mentors/lead mentors at the schools and moderated by the District-level Assessors.
The Regional Assessor will verify the District Assessors’ evaluations of NQTs’ portfolios in line with the agreed evaluation criteria and National Teaching Councils’ Teachers’ Standards. Each Regional Assessor will verify an assigned number of District samples.
Required Skills or Experience
Qualifications
Prospective applicants applying from Teacher Training Institutions must:
- Possess a minimum of a Master’s degree In Education or a Master’s degree in training subject area and a certificate in Post-Graduate Diploma in Education,
- Be at the position of either a Tutor or a Lecturer
- Have worked as a Supervisor in a school, a Head of Department or a member of school management for a minimum of 2 years in a recognised educational institution.
- Be at least assistant examiner for the past two years
